Wickes Group plc is a UK home improvement retailer that sells building materials, tools, kitchens, bathrooms, and garden products. Its customers are mainly everyday homeowners doing DIY projects and smaller trade professionals like builders and plumbers. Wickes operates around 230 stores across Great Britain and is one of the country's well-known names in the home improvement space. The company makes money through in-store and online product sales, plus a growing installation business where it designs and fits kitchens and bathrooms for customers. It operates entirely in the UK, giving it a focused but geographically limited footprint, with a market cap of roughly £0.4 billion. Its trade customer base and installation services provide some loyalty, but the business is sensitive to the UK housing market — when people stop moving homes or cutting spending, demand for home improvement projects tends to fall, which is the key risk it faces today.
